Got about 5kg of Damsons (so far) . A tree full of Bramleys. Bags of Blackberries in the freezer. Autumn Raspberries. Sloes in a few weeks. Rosehips when I get my arse in gear and go hunt some etc etc so I'm covered with the basic fruit jams.... however, do any of you have any twists on these traditional flavours? Any boozy recipes?

Little drop of brandy into blackberry jam as you put lids on. Gives hint of brandy and thins it better for spreading.

did a batch of blackberry and apple jam last month - it's great

the other year i did an apple jam with honey, cinnamon and walnuts, that wasn't bad too

my current thing is blackberry vinegar - ace as a dressing on salads etc 🙂
